As a business owner, you would have some objectives and goals in mind where you want to see your business, for example, in five years. That could be opening more shops or reaching new regions. However, you need to ensure your business is going in the right direction to achieve them because what you are doing today triggers success in the future. A business plan is not something in mind. It is written on paper with clear actions and milestones until you reach your goal. To do that, you should be able to answer the following questions:
- Is my business in the right direction?
- What should be done to reach my objectives?
- How can I make sure to achieve my long-term objectives?
- What business tools and methods are the best way to achieve my objectives?
- What is the position of my business in the current market, and what strategic planning do I need?
